Believe nothing until it has been officially denied.

Claud Cockburn (1904–1981), British journalist, In Time of Trouble (1956), Jay p.100

How gullible are you? How suspicious? When did either aspect of your character get you in trouble? What have you learned from those experiences?

The reason why an official denial is thought necessary is because nobody believed the unofficial denial. Take both with a grain of salt.
